.stats-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(120px,1fr));gap:12px;margin-top:20px}.stat-card{background:var(--bg-3);border:1px solid var(--line);border-radius:var(--radius-m);padding:16px;text-align:center}.stat-card-num{display:block;font-family:var(--font-mono);font-size:28px;font-weight:600;color:var(--accent);line-height:1.2}.stat-card-label{display:block;font-size:12px;color:var(--text-faint);margin-top:4px;letter-spacing:.04em}.count-section{margin-top:24px}.count-section-title{font-family:var(--font-mono);font-size:11px;color:var(--text-faint);letter-spacing:.08em;text-transform:uppercase;margin-bottom:12px}.freq-list{display:flex;flex-wrap:wrap;gap:8px}.freq-item{display:inline-flex;align-items:center;gap:6px;background:var(--bg-3);border:1px solid var(--line);border-radius:var(--radius-s);padding:6px 12px;font-family:var(--font-mono);font-size:13px}.freq-item .freq-word{color:var(--text)}.freq-item .freq-count{color:var(--accent);font-weight:600}.freq-bar-wrap{margin-top:16px}.freq-bar-row{display:flex;align-items:center;gap:8px;margin-bottom:6px}.freq-bar-label{font-family:var(--font-mono);font-size:12px;color:var(--text-dim);min-width:60px;text-align:right;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.freq-bar-track{flex:1;height:16px;background:var(--bg-3);border-radius:3px;overflow:hidden}.freq-bar-fill{height:100%;background:var(--accent);border-radius:3px;transition:width .3s;min-width:2px}.freq-bar-val{font-family:var(--font-mono);font-size:11px;color:var(--text-faint);min-width:28px}.reading-info{display:flex;gap:24px;margin-top:12px;font-family:var(--font-mono);font-size:12px;color:var(--text-dim)}.reading-info span{display:flex;align-items:center;gap:4px}
